Packing cubes keep your luggage tidy

Packing cubes ideally organize your luggage when hiking with a backpack

If you want to keep your luggage in order in a simple way, we can recommend Packing Cubes: These are small, rectangular pockets with zippers that you can use to sort the contents of your rucksack very easily. This saves a lot of fiddling.

The things are mostly made of light nylon and weigh almost nothing. The packing cubes are available from, among others Amazon.
